Daniel G. is an artist and a PhD. graduated from the University of Barcelona (2015), in his work Daniel questions dominant discourses built by Factual powers over identity, work, class or consumption that convert forms of fiction and / or reality. Daniel started his trajectory combining artistic research and production, investigating the mechanisms that constitute hegemonic narratives.
Since 2016 he has obtained several scholarships such as the P. Juncosa Education Grant (Mallorca 2016), Inter Scholarship. ETAC (Mallorca 2016), Casa Elizalde Visual Arts Scholarship, UNZIP (El Prat de Llobregat 2017), Scholarship of Education Sala d’Art Jove (2018), Scholarship for artistic experimentation and research La Escocesa (2019) and he is part of the Asimetries research group at Fabra i Coats de Idensitat (Barcelona 2018/19). Since 2018 develops the design and content of projects from the Interseccions Arts Visuals program of the City Council of El Prat de Llobregat, Daniel is the coordinator of Suport a la Creació de Escola d’Arts Visuals del Prat.
